Rent a Furnished Apartment in Berlin: Pros, Cons, and What Expats Should Know

Berlin has long been a magnet for students, freelancers, digital nomads, and young professionals. But in recent years, securing a place to live in this dynamic city remains one of the most challenging aspects of relocating. One increasingly popular option—especially for newcomers—is to rent a furnished apartment in Berlin.

Whether you’re staying for a few months or planning to settle long term, choosing a furnished rental can offer both comfort and convenience. But is it always the right choice? This guide breaks down the pros and cons of furnished apartments in Berlin and what to consider before signing a lease.

Why Furnished Apartments Are Popular in Berlin

A Flexible Solution for a Mobile City

Berlin is a transient city. Thousands of people arrive each year for university programs, tech jobs, artistic residencies, or start-up roles. Furnished apartments are ideal for those who:

  • Don’t have their own furniture
  • Are relocating from abroad
  • Need short-term housing before finding a long-term flat
  • Want to avoid the hassle of setting up utilities and internet

Growing Demand, Shrinking Availability

The demand for furnished flats in Berlin has grown significantly in recent years. Especially in central districts like Mitte, Friedrichshain, and Kreuzberg, the waiting lists for unfurnished units are long and the competition is steep. Furnished options offer a practical shortcut into the Berlin housing market without the endless apartment viewings and document battles.

The Pros of Renting a Furnished Flats in Berlin

1. Move-In Ready Convenience

One of the biggest advantages of renting furnished is that you can arrive with just a suitcase. The apartment is already equipped with:

  • Bed, wardrobe, and seating
  • Kitchen appliances and utensils
  • Wi-Fi and utility services in most cases

This eliminates the upfront costs and logistical headaches of buying furniture, waiting on deliveries, and setting up accounts with various utility providers.

2. Easier for International Arrivals

For expats, international students, and digital workers, dealing with German bureaucracy can be overwhelming. Furnished apartments often come with Anmeldung (registration) included, a vital requirement for visa processing, opening a bank account, and securing health insurance.

3. Short-Term Contracts and Flexibility

Unlike standard unfurnished rentals, which often require two- to three-year commitments, many furnished apartments offer flexible lease terms—from a few months to a year or more. This makes them perfect for people unsure about how long they’ll stay in Berlin or those exploring different neighborhoods before settling.

4. Lower Upfront Costs

While furnished apartments typically have higher monthly rents, you save significantly on upfront costs:

  • No need to purchase furniture or household items
  • Utility bills often included
  • Minimal renovation or decoration costs
  • Lower moving expenses

The Cons of Renting a Furnished Properties

1. Higher Monthly Rent

Furnished apartments in Berlin generally cost 15% upwards more than comparable unfurnished ones. While this premium includes convenience, it can be a long-term financial burden if you’re planning to stay for several years.

2. Limited Personalization

You can’t always decorate or rearrange a furnished apartment to your liking. Most landlords require the furniture to remain in place and in good condition. That means less freedom to make the space truly yours.

3. Fewer Long-Term Offers

Furnished flats are often aimed at short- or mid-term renters. As a result, you may face annual renewals, rising rents, or the need to move again if the landlord decides not to extend the lease.

4. Wear and Tear Liability

Accidental damage to provided furniture may be deducted from your deposit, even with regular use. Make sure to document the apartment’s condition upon move-in to avoid future disputes.

What to Check Before Renting a Furnished Apartment

Before signing a rental agreement, verify the following:

  • Does the rent include utilities (Warmmiete)?
  • Is Anmeldung (registration) possible?
  • What is the minimum stay period?
  • Is the deposit refundable and clearly outlined in the contract?
  • What furniture and equipment are included?
  • Are photos and the actual condition of the flat aligned?
  • Who handles repairs and maintenance?

It’s also important to clarify what happens if you need to end the lease early—especially for visa-related or professional changes.
